JUMBO BLUEBERRY MUFFINS RECIPE: HOW TO MAKE IT
In Michigan there are lots of blueberries, so I enjoy trying recipes with them, like a jumbo version of a classic muffin. — Jackie Hannahs, Brethren, Michigan
Provided by Taste of Home
Total Time 35 minutes
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Yield 8 jumbo muffins.
Number Of Ingredients 13
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 400°. In a large bowl, cream butter and sugar until light and fluffy, 5-7 minutes. Add eggs, one at a time, beating well after each addition. Beat in buttermilk and vanilla. In another bowl, whisk flour, baking powder and salt. Add to creamed mixture; stir just until moistened. Fold in blueberries., Fill greased or paper-lined jumbo muffin cups two-thirds full. Mix topping ingredients; sprinkle over tops. Bake 20-25 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in center comes out clean. Cool 5 minutes before removing from pan to a wire rack. Serve warm.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 375 calories, FatContent 13g fat (8g saturated fat), CholesterolContent 84mg cholesterol, SodiumContent 289mg sodium, CarbohydrateContent 60g carbohydrate (35g sugars, FiberContent 2g fiber), ProteinContent 6g protein.
BLUEBERRY YOGURT MUFFINS RECIPE: HOW TO MAKE IT
With the addition of vanilla yogurt, this basic muffin turns out moist and tender. It’s easy and quick to prepare. My husband loves these muffins for breakfast on mornings when he is rushing out the door. —Cindi Budreau, Neenah, Wisconsin
Provided by Taste of Home
Total Time 35 minutes
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Yield 6 muffins.
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- In a small bowl, combine the flour, sugar, salt, baking powder and baking soda. In another bowl, combine the egg, yogurt, oil and milk. Stir into dry ingredients just until moistened. Fold in blueberries., Fill greased or paper-lined muffin cups three-fourths full. Bake at 350° for 20-22 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. Cool for 5 minutes before removing from pan to a wire rack. Serve warm.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 228 calories, FatContent 9g fat (1g saturated fat), CholesterolContent 38mg cholesterol, SodiumContent 195mg sodium, CarbohydrateContent 33g carbohydrate (17g sugars, FiberContent 1g fiber), ProteinContent 4g protein.

BLUEBERRY OATMEAL MUFFINS RECIPE: HOW TO MAKE IT
From tasteofhome.com
Reviews 4.7
Total Time 30 minutes
Calories 167 calories per serving
- Preheat oven to 400°. In a large bowl, combine the first eight ingredients. Combine the egg, yogurt and butter; stir into dry ingredients just until moistened. Fold in blueberries. , Coat muffin cups with cooking spray or use paper liners; fill three-fourths full with batter. Bake until a toothpick inserted in the muffin comes out clean, 18-22 minutes. Cool for 5 minutes before removing from pan to a wire rack. Serve warm., Freeze option:: Wrap muffins in foil; transfer to a resealable plastic freezer bag. May be frozen for up to 3 months. To use frozen muffins: Remove foil. Thaw at room temperature. Serve warm.

OLD-FASHIONED BLUEBERRY MUFFINS RECIPE: HOW TO MAKE IT
From tasteofhome.com
Reviews 4.7
Total Time 30 minutes
Category Breakfast, Brunch
Calories 192 calories per serving
- In a small bowl, combine the flour, sugar, baking powder and salt. In another bowl, whisk the egg, milk, butter and vanilla; stir into dry ingredients just until moistened. Fold in blueberries., Fill greased or paper-lined muffin cups three-fourths full. Bake at 400° for 18-22 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. Cool for 5 minutes before removing from pan to a wire rack. Serve warm.
